Which recommendation is appropriate for meeting these requirements?

Get Cloudy Consulting has a custom Contract object that requires Org-Wide Defaults set to Private. The owner of the Contract record will be the Contract Origination Officer, and the Contract record must be shared with a certain Underwriter on a contract-by-contract basis. The Underwriters should only see the Contract records for which they are assigned.

Which recommendation is appropriate for meeting these requirements?
A . Create a master-detail relationship from the Contract to the User object. Contract records will be automatically shared with the Underwriter.
B . Use criteria-based sharing rules to share the Contract object with the Underwriter based upon the criteria defined in the criteria-based sharing.
C . Create an Apex Sharing Reason on the Contract object that shares the Contract with the Underwriter based upon the criteria defined in the Sharing Reason.
D . Create a lookup relationship from the Contract object to the User object. Use a trigger on the Contract object to create the corresponding record in the Contract Share object

Answer: B

Subscribe
Notify of
guest
0 Comments
Inline Feedbacks
View all comments